Buying a used Ford Escape (8M6T10849H) speedometer gauge cluster from the 2009 or 2010 model with approximately 112,000 miles can be a viable option for those in need of a replacement. However, it's essential to consider the potential pros and cons before making a purchase.
Pros:1. Cost-effective: Buying a used cluster can save a significant amount of money compared to purchasing a new one from the dealership.
2. Availability: Used clusters are more readily available on the aftermarket, making it easier to find a matching part.
3. Functional: A used cluster, if in good condition, will function just like a new one, providing accurate speedometer, tachometer, and other essential gauge readings.
Cons:1. Potential for pre-existing issues: A used cluster may have pre-existing damage or issues that could impact its performance or appearance.
2. Installation complexity: Installing a used cluster can be more complex than swapping out a single gauge, requiring the removal of the entire dashboard and cluster disassembly.
3. Risk of compatibility issues: There's a possibility that the used cluster may not be compatible with certain features or modifications on your vehicle.
Ending Conclusion:When considering purchasing a used Ford Escape (8M6T10849H) speedometer gauge cluster from the 2009 or 2010 model with approximately 112,000 miles, it's essential to weigh the potential pros and cons. Buying a used cluster can save you money and provide a functional replacement, but it may come with pre-existing issues, installation complexity, and compatibility risks.
Recommendation:If you decide to purchase a used cluster, make sure to inspect it thoroughly before making the purchase. Look for any visible signs of damage, ensure all the gauges work correctly, and ask the seller for any relevant documentation or information regarding the cluster's history. Additionally, consider seeking professional installation assistance to minimize the risk of complications during the installation process.
